The problem

Drop day. Two customers add your last unit at the same moment. Both head to checkout. Both pay. One of them gets the product, and the other gets a refund, an apology email, and a reason to never trust your launches again.

It happens because Shopify's inventory only decrements when an order completes. The whole time a customer is checking out, the stock they're buying is still up for grabs.
